手机版 收藏 导航

如何实现ip服务商的负载均衡

原创   www.link114.cn   2024-10-22 13:55:48

如何实现ip服务商的负载均衡

对于IP服务商来说,负载均衡是至关重要的。它可以提高系统的可靠性和可用性。当某一个服务器出现故障时,负载均衡系统可以迅速将访问流量转移到其他健康的服务器上,从而确保业务的持续运行。负载均衡可以提高系统的性能和响应速度。通过将访问流量分散到多个服务器上,可以充分利用系统资源,避免单一服务器的过载。负载均衡还可以帮助IP服务商实现更加灵活的扩展,根据业务需求动态调整资源配置。

IP服务商通常采用以下几种负载均衡方式:

DNS负载均衡

DNS负载均衡是最简单的一种方式。服务商可以将同一个域名解析到多个IP地址,并根据预先设置的策略,随机或轮流地返回这些IP地址。这种方式易于实现,但缺乏细粒度的控制和故障检测能力。

硬件负载均衡

硬件负载均衡设备是一种专门的网络设备,它可以监控后端服务器的状态,并根据预定的算法将访问流量分派到合适的服务器上。这种方式可以提供更加灵活和强大的负载均衡功能,但成本较高,需要专门的维护和管理。

软件负载均衡

软件负载均衡是指在应用程序层面实现负载均衡。例如,在Web服务器前添加一个反向代理服务器,由它来管理和分发访问流量。这种方式灵活性强,成本较低,但需要对应用程序进行一定程度的改造。

选择合适的负载均衡策略需要考虑多方面因素,如系统规模、业务特点、预算等。通常来说,小规模的IP服务商可以选择DNS负载均衡或软件负载均衡,而大规模的服务商则更适合采用硬件负载均衡。不同的负载均衡算法,如轮询、加权轮询、最少连接等,也需要根据实际需求进行选择和测试。

无论采用何种负载均衡方式,IP服务商都需要注意以下几点:

  1. 实时监控后端服务器状态,及时发现并隔离故障服务器。
  2. 制定灵活的扩展策略,根据业务需求动态调整资源配置。
  3. 定期测试和优化负载均衡系统,确保其稳定高效地运行。
  4. 制定完善的容灾和备份机制,以确保业务的连续性。

通过合理的负载均衡策略和最佳实践,IP服务商可以大大提升系统的可靠性和性能,从而为用户提供更加优质的网络服务。